
var tsukarebase;
var tsukare_input;
var chktxt;
var tsukare_radio = [];
var whitebox;
var ans;

var imgnew = new Image();


function tsukareChkEv(){
	
	
ukk.Event.add(ukk.$('checkbtn'), 'click',tsukareChk,false);
ukk.Event.add(ukk.$('resetbtn'), 'click',tsukareChkCl,false);
tsukarebase = ukk.$('tsukareCheck');
tsukare_input = ukk.getElementsByTagNameArray('input',tsukarebase);
for(var i=0;i<tsukare_input.length;i++){
	if(tsukare_input[i].type == 'radio'){
		tsukare_radio[tsukare_radio.length] = tsukare_input[i];
		tsukare_input[i].checked = false;
	}else if(tsukare_input[i].type == 'text') {
		tsukare_input[i].value = 0;
	}
}

ans = ukk.$('ansBox');
chktxt = ukk.getElementsByTagNameArray('img',ans);
whitebox = document.createElement('div');
ukk.Style.add(whitebox,{'opacity':'0.5','height':(tsukarebase.offsetHeight-5) + 'px'})
whitebox.id = 'whitebox';


ukk.$('innerid').appendChild(whitebox);

ans.style.top = (tsukarebase.offsetHeight / 2) - 75 + 'px';

ukk.Event.add(whitebox, 'click',boxclose,false);
ukk.Event.add(ans, 'click',boxclose,false);


}


function tsukareChk(){
	


var total = 0;
var c2total = 0;
var c3total = 0;
var count = 0;

var c2chk = ukk.$$('c2',tsukarebase);
var c3chk = ukk.$$('c3',tsukarebase);

for(var i=0;i<tsukare_radio.length;i++){
	if(tsukare_radio[i].checked == true){
		count++;
	}	
}

if(count != c2chk.length){
	whitebox.style.display = 'block';
	ans.style.display = 'block';
	chktxt[0].src = 'images/checkans_im_00.gif';
	return;
}

for(var i=0;i<c2chk.length;i++){
	if(c2chk[i].checked == true){
		c2total++;
		total++;
	}
}

for(var i=0;i<c3chk.length;i++){
	if(c3chk[i].checked == true){
		c3total+=2;
		total+=2;
	}
}

if(total == 0){
chktxt[0].src = 'images/checkans_im_01.gif';
}else if(total >=1 && total <= 7){
chktxt[0].src = 'images/checkans_im_02.gif';
}else if(total >=8 && total <= 15){
chktxt[0].src = 'images/checkans_im_03.gif';
}else if(total >=16 && total <= 20){
chktxt[0].src = 'images/checkans_im_04.gif';
}

ukk.$('t1').value = 0;
ukk.$('t2').value = c2total;
ukk.$('t3').value = c3total;
ukk.$('t4').value = total;

whitebox.style.display = 'block';
ans.style.display = 'block';

}

function tsukareChkCl(){

for(var i=0;i<tsukare_input.length;i++){
tsukare_input[i].checked = false;
}

ukk.$('t1').value = 0;
ukk.$('t2').value = 0;
ukk.$('t3').value = 0;
ukk.$('t4').value = 0;
}


function boxclose(){
	chktxt[0].src = '';

	ukk.$('ansBox').style.display = 'none';
	whitebox.style.display = 'none';
}

new Image().src = 'images/checkans_im_01.gif';
new Image().src = 'images/checkans_im_02.gif';
new Image().src = 'images/checkans_im_03.gif';
new Image().src = 'images/checkans_im_04.gif';



ukk.DOMready.tgFunc(tsukareChkEv);

